InterpreterFactory

InterpreterFactory di classe pubblica

Factory per la costruzione di istanze di InterpreterApi.

Deprecato; utilizzare invece il metodo InterpreterApi.create.

Costruttori pubblici

Metodi pubblici

InterpreterApi
crea (Opzioni file modelFile, InterpreterApi.Options )
Costruisce un'istanza InterpreterApi , utilizzando il modello e le opzioni specificati.
InterpreterApi
crea (opzioni ByteBuffer byteBuffer, InterpreterApi.Options )
Costruisce un'istanza InterpreterApi , utilizzando il modello e le opzioni specificati.

Metodi ereditati

Costruttori pubblici

public InterpreterFactory ()

Metodi pubblici

creazione pubblica di InterpreterApi ( file modelFile, opzioni InterpreterApi.Options )

Costruisce un'istanza InterpreterApi , utilizzando il modello e le opzioni specificati. Il modello verrà caricato da un file.

Parametri
modelFile Un file contenente un modello TF Lite pre-addestrato.
opzioni Una serie di opzioni per personalizzare il comportamento dell'interprete.
Lancia
IllegalArgumentException se modelFile non codifica un modello TensorFlow Lite valido.

creazione pubblica di InterpreterApi (opzioni ByteBuffer byteBuffer, InterpreterApi.Options )

Costruisce un'istanza InterpreterApi , utilizzando il modello e le opzioni specificati. Il modello verrà letto da un ByteBuffer .

Parametri
byteBuffer Un modello TF Lite pre-addestrato, in formato serializzato binario. Il ByteBuffer non deve essere modificato dopo la costruzione di un'istanza InterpreterApi . Il ByteBuffer può essere un MappedByteBuffer che mappa in memoria un file di modello o un ByteBuffer diretto di nativeOrder() che contiene il contenuto in byte di un modello.
opzioni Una serie di opzioni per personalizzare il comportamento dell'interprete.
Lancia
IllegalArgumentException se byteBuffer non è un MappedByteBuffer né un ByteBuffer diretto di nativeOrder.